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We’ll send our team to inspect the damage and assess the situation. We’ll identify the source of the water, the extent of the damage, and the best course of action to take.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ify any potential health risks. We’ll provide you with a clear understanding of what needs to be done and how long it will take.
Step 2: Containment and Drying
We’ll set up containment equipment to prevent further damage and begin the drying process. Our team will use specialized equipment to extract water from the affected area and begin the drying process. We’ll work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the drying process is complete, our team will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ent any further damage or health risks.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ove any remaining water and debris, and then sanitize the area to prevent any potential health risks.
Step 4: Reconstruction and Repair
After the cleaning and sanitizing process, our team will begin the reconstruction and repair process. We’ll work with you to ensure that the repairs meet your needs and budget. We’ll use high-quality materials and workmanship to ensure that the repairs are done right the first time.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in New Territory, TX
The cost of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ration in New Territory, TX, can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can give you an idea of what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Containment and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ed |
| Reconstruction and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ed |
| Moisture Control and Prevention |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
